How to Visit the Please Touch Museum

If you are looking for a fun and educational museum for both children and adults, you should consider the Please Touch Museum in Philadelphia. The museum, located on 21st Street, offers numerous interactive exhibits that encourage active participation from visitors.

Instructions

    • 1

      Consider a museum membership. You can purchase a daily pass for your visit, but you may want to ask about becoming a member of the museum. Members have unlimited visits to the museum, subscription to the Please Touch Museum newsletter and special discounts.

    • 2

      Take the kids to the Please Touch Museum. Most of the exhibits are geared towards children under the age of 10. However, older children and adults will also enjoy the exhibits.

    • 3

      Start with the Alice's Adventures in Wonderland exhibit. Fans of Alice in Wonderland will enjoy sipping tea with the Mad Hatter, entering the Hall of Doors and Mirrors or playing croquet with the Queen of Hearts.

    • 4

      Make time for the Move It section of the museum. In this area, you can drive a real Philadelphia bus and sail a boat on the museum's man-made river.

    • 5

      Visit the Kid's Store. The store has many fun and educational toys available for purchase. You can find train sets, shovels and puzzles at a reasonable cost.

Tips & Warnings

  • Avoid visiting the Please Touch Museum on rainy days. The museum will be less busy on days with pleasant weather.

  • There is not a restaurant inside of the Please Touch Museum. You can find snacks and drinks in the Recycled City section of the museum.
